Unveiling Music Distribution: A Step-by-Step Breakdown

Navigating the world of music distribution can seem overwhelming, especially for get more info independent musicians just starting out. But fear not! With a clear understanding of the process and some strategic planning, you can easily get your music heard by a wider audience. Let's break down the steps involved in sharing your tracks:

  • First choosing a reputable music distribution platform. Well-known options include DistroKid, TuneCore, CD Baby, and Amuse. Each platform has its own set of features. Consider your needs and budget when making your decision.

  • Then, prepare your music for distribution. This involves ensuring high-quality audio files, creating eye-catching artwork, and writing compelling track metadata (title, artist name, genre, etc.).
  • Once your music is ready, upload it to your chosen distribution platform. Follow their instructions carefully and double-check all the information before proceeding.
  • Finally, promote your release! Share your music on social media, reach out to blogs and playlists, and interact with your fans.
